Course Details
• Introduction to Next-Gen Plyometric Training - definitions, benefits, and principles
• Assessing Athletic Readiness - functional movement screening, fitness assessments
• Designing Plyometric Training Programs - periodization, progressions, and regressions
• Plyometric Exercises for Lower Body - squat jumps, lunge jumps, box jumps
• Plyometric Exercises for Upper Body - medicine ball throws, clap push-ups
• Integrating Plyometrics with Other Training Methods - strength, endurance, and flexibility
• Safety Considerations - equipment, technique, and injury prevention
• Monitoring Progress and Adjusting Programs - tracking performance, modifying training
• Case Studies and Practical Applications - real-world examples and scenarios
